Optimizing HPL Benchmark on Multi-GPU Clusters

Abstract: The current high performance Linpack benchmark accelerated by GPU usually employs the performance-based dynamic load balancing algorism. However, this algorism does not perform well on multi-GPU cluster. The reason is that each GPU on this kind of node has a smaller calculating scale, and the gap of the total performance between GPU and CPU is larger. Therefore, this article proposed an experience-based dynamic load balancing algorism and a multi-GPU adaptive load balance algorithm. Besides, the article tested these two algorisms on multi-GPU cluster and it achieves a 6.3% acceleration compared with the latest NV)DIA's HPL accelerated by GPU.
